Taxonomic Classification

Rank Dusky Leaf-nosed Bat Ground Beetle
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Arthropoda (Arthropods)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Insecta (Insects)
Order Chiroptera (Bats) Coleoptera (Beetles)
Family Hipposideridae Carabidae
Genus Hipposideros Calathus
Species Hipposideros ater Calathus carvalhoi
